SpletThe short answer: yes! Here’s how to make sure your tire pressure is always right in cold weather. Find your vehicle’s recommended tyre pressure. Check your tyre pressure every two weeks. Air pressure drops by 1-2 PSI or 0.07 to 0.14 bar with every 10°C. Studded winter tyres also need regular maintenance. SpletLook well ahead for potential hazards – including, of course, patches of ice – and keep your speed well down. Accelerate, brake, steer and change gear as smoothly as possible to reduce the risk of a skid. A higher gear may be more appropriate to aid grip on packed ice. The tread on … Splet31. mar. 2024 · The Acura SH-AWD isn’t just about all-weather vector traction control. The SH-AWD delivers dynamic vector torque to provide more predictable and precise handling performance in all road conditions. Up to 70% of the torque from the engine can be sent to the rear wheels as needed, or 100% of that torque is distributed to the left or right wheels.

Splet24. jan. 2024 · Traction control essentially controls the amount of power that goes to each wheel when you press on the gas pedal. If the system detects that a wheel is starting to spin, it will decrease the power going to that wheel. If your car is on a snowy or icy road and you slam on the gas, the car won’t move at all if the traction control is engaged. Splet05. jul. 2024 · The Sun Affects The Track. On a cool, sunny day of around 60-degrees Fahrenheit, track temperature can be 10 degrees hotter. At our local track near the coastline, the lower limit of the surface temperature for reasonable traction is in the low 60’s. It is hard to hook up below that temperature.
